> So reiserfs thinks the devices is 64K larger than it really is. I
> wonder how that happened.
> resize_reiserfs -s -64K /dev/md1
Neil, I discovered how the "64k larger" issue happened...
It was my fault.. I created the Reiser filesystem *before* the
raid device. So when I create the raid device, it warns about a
existing reiserfs filesystem and if I want to continue. This way, the
underlying filesystem will be always 64k large than the raid device.
If, instead, I use the correct method of creating the raid
device *before*, everything is ok, because then I can "mkreiserfs" the
raid device and the filesystem will have the correct size the raid
device expects.
